abrdn plc Has $23.62 Million Holdings in Cogent Communications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:CCOI)

abrdn plc cut its stake in Cogent Communications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:CCOIFree Report) by 20.4%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 310,547 shares of the technology company’s stock after selling 79,577 shares during the period. abrdn plc owned about 0.64% of Cogent Communications worth $23,620,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Cogent Communications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, April 9th. Shareholders of record on Friday, March 15th were issued a dividend of $0.965 per share. The ex-dividend date was Thursday, March 14th. This is a positive change from Cogent Communications’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.96. This represents a $3.86 annualized dividend and a yield of 6.00%. Cogent Communications’s payout ratio is currently 14.43%.

About Cogent Communications

(Free Report)

Cogent Communications Holdings, Inc, through its subsidiaries, provides high-speed Internet access, private network, and data center colocation space services in North America, Europe, Oceania, South America, and Africa. The company offers on-net Internet access and private network services to law firms, financial services firms, and advertising and marketing firms, as well as heath care providers, educational institutions and other professional services businesses, other Internet service providers, telephone companies, cable television companies, web hosting companies, media service providers, mobile phone operators, content delivery network companies, and commercial content and application service providers.
